#544449 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#544449 is composed of 32.9% red, 26.7%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 341.3 degrees, a saturation of 10.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#544449 color hex could be obtained by blending #a88892 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#544449 color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#544449 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#544449 has RGB values of R:84, G:68,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.13,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5522505.

Shades and Tints of #544449
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080707 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#544449
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4a4b is the less saturated color, while #940431 is the most saturated one.
